Obong Victor Bassey Attah listen (born 20 November 1938) was Governor of Akwa Ibom State in Nigeria from 29 May 1999 to 29 May 2007. [1] He was a member of the Board of Trustees of the People's Democratic Party (PDP),but has since joined the All Progressives Congress. [2]
Obong Victor Attah was born on 20 November 1938. He completed post-primary education in 1956. He gained a degree from Leeds College of Art and a post graduate diploma in Building Science from Liverpool University in 1965. He won the scholarship to study at Columbia University in New York,where he obtained an MA in Advanced Architectural Design and Planning. He also attended the Kennedy Graduate School of Governance at Harvard University. After completing his education,he practised as an architect in the Caribbean,New York City,and Nigeria. He served as the National President of the Nigerian Institute of Architects. [2]
He was part of the Peoples Democratic Movement led by Shehu Musa Yar'Adua in the aborted Sani Abacha transition program together with politicians such as Atiku Abubakar,Abdullahi Aliyu Sumaila,Magaji Abdullahi,Chuba Okadigbo and Sunday Afolabi. Victor Attah was elected governor of Akwa Ibom in 1999 on the Akwa Ibom PDP platform,and was re-elected in 2003. He was elected Chairman of the Forum of the 36 Governors of Nigeria in 2003. [3]
In 2001,Attah travelled to the United States with as many as 21 people in search of foreign investors. This visit and others produced tangible results. [4] He promised to improve telecoms,power supply,and air transport infrastructure,and to replicate Silicon Valley in Uyo. [5] He planned to build an airport in Uyo before he left office in 2007. [6] He laid the foundation for the establishment of the Akwa Ibom State University of Technology. [7]
Attah ran for the presidential nomination of the Peoples Democratic Party in 2007,but later withdrew. [8]
Obong Victor Attah retired from politics after losing the PDP candidacy for presidency in 2007. He spent time with his Wife Alison who is suffering from Type 2 Diabetes.
In March 2008,Victor Attah joined ExecutiveAction,a consultancy that helps firms manage problems in difficult business environments. [9]
On November 24,2018,in a public statement,Governor Udom Emmanuel of Akwa Ibom state,renamed Akwa Ibom International Airport to Victor Attah International Airport,It was named after the ex-governor to honour him for being the founder of the airport while he was in power from 1999 to 2007. [10]
Akwa Ibom State is a state in the South-South geopolitical zone of Nigeriaon the east by Cross River State,on the west by Rivers State and Abia State,and on the south by the Atlantic Ocean. The state takes its name from the Qua Iboe River which bisects the state before flowing into the Bight of Bonny. Akwa Ibom was split from Cross River State in 1987 with its capital Uyo and with 31 local government areas.

Ibom Power Company Limited (IPC) is one of the first independent power plants in Nigeria inaugurated by former President Olusegun Obasanjo during the administration of Obong Victor Attah. It is a gas-fired power plant located in Ikot Abasi,Akwa Ibom State. The company has its corporate office in Uyo,the Akwa Ibom State capital with a liaison office at FCT Abuja. Ibom Power was registered and incorporated with the Corporate Affairs Commission (CAC) in January 2001 by Akwa Ibom Investment and Industrial Promotion Council “AKIIPOC”now Akwa Ibom Investment Corporation (AKICORP). The Company is solely owned by the Akwa Ibom State Government. The Nigerian Electricity Regulatory Commission licensed Ibom Power to generate 191megawatts of power in May 2008. The license was increased from 191megawatts to 685Megawatts in November 2015. The 191megawatts Ibom power plant receives gas from Accugas,a subsidiary of Seven Energy (now Savannah Energy) based on a 10-year Gas Sales and Purchase Agreement,GSPA. The gas is transported from a Gas Processing Facility at Uquo in Esit Eket LGA to a Gas Receiving Facility in Ikot Abasi. Ibom power plant evacuates its output through a 49 km 132kV transmission line from Ikot Abasi to Eket 132/33kV double circuit substation. From Eket transmission substation,the power is transported to the transmission substation at Afaha Ube,in Uyo,from Uyo to Itu,and from Itu to the national grid at Alaoji,Abia State. Ibom Power has had three different Managing Directors. The pioneering MD,Mr. Gareth Wilcox,a Briton,led the company’s management from 2001 to May 2014. His successor,Dr. Victor Udo led the company from June 2014 to 31 July 2016. Engr. Meyen Etukudo succeeded Dr. Udo. Engr. Etukudo has led the company from 1 August 2016 to date. Ibom Power’s highest decision-making body is the Board of Directors led by Engr. Etido Inyang as the Chairman of the Board of Directors. The Directors are Barr. Uwem Ekanem,Hon. Ayang Ayang and Hon. Emmanuel Ebe. Ibom power has only one customer;the Nigerian Bulk Electricity Trading Company Plc,NBET.
